Sport Vibes – Manchester United Ownership

Sheikh Jassim has withdrawn from the bidding process of acquiring Manchester United after the Glazers rejected the Qatari businessman’s proposal to buy 100% of Manchester United. Glazers, who have owned United since 2005 appear to be more interested in Sir Jim Ratcliffe’s bid to pay £1.3bn for 25 percent of the club. #sportvibes#manchesterunited#JamesGlory

Sport Vibes-Max Verstappen (World Champion)

Max Verstappen wins his third Formula 1 world championship. Max joins F1 elite drivers as he becomes the fifth driver to win three championships in a row. The Red Bull driver is having one of the most dominant seasons in F1 history, winning his fourteenth race this season. #sportvibes#maxverstappen#Formula1

Sport Vibes- Ryder Cup

Europe regains the Ryder Cup defeating the United State 16.5-11.5 in Rome. Team Europe won the biennial golf competition after losing out in 2021. Rory Mcllroy led the way with a ferocious start before the crowd and Tommy Fleetwood helped deliver the decisive point to extend Europe’s dominance over the Americans on home soil. #sportvibes#Rydercup#RoryMcllroy

Sport Vibes – Newcastle United

Newcastle United becomes the first team in Premier League history to have eight different goal- scorers in one game after thrashing Sheffield United 8-0 at Bramall Lane. Sheffield United suffered their worst-ever league defeat as Eddie Howe’s side got their biggest away from home. #Newcastleunited##Sportvibes#news

Sport Vibes – The Singapore GP

Ferrari’s Carlos Sainz won the Singapore Grand Prix as Red Bull’s and Max Verstappen’s season-long dominance of Formula 1 comes to an end after an all-time record of 10 consecutive victories. McLaren’s Lando Norris and the Mercedes of Lewis Hamilton finished second and third respectively. #SingaporeGP#LewisHamilton#sportvibes

Drug Misuse And It’s Pharmacological Effect- Dr. Ify Chizor

Many people who misuse drugs according to National Library of Medicine use a range of substances concurrently and regularly (Known as Polydrug misuse). Also, drug dependence is associated with a high incidence of criminal activity with associated costs to the criminal justice system in the UK estimated as reaching one billion pounds per anum. #drugabuse#drugmisuse#letstalk
